India - Gross value added at factor cost (constant LCU)

The value for Gross value added at factor cost (constant LCU) in India was 124,534,000,000,000 as of 2020. As the graph below shows, over the past 60 years this indicator reached a maximum value of 132,715,000,000,000 in 2019 and a minimum value of 7,031,380,000,000 in 1960.

Definition: Gross value added at factor cost (formerly GDP at factor cost) is derived as the sum of the value added in the agriculture, industry and services sectors. If the value added of these sectors is calculated at purchaser values, gross value added at factor cost is derived by subtracting net product taxes from GDP. Data are in constant local currency.

Source: World Bank national accounts data, and OECD National Accounts data files.
